# Database connectivity preflight
check_database() {
# Keep resolution order aligned with backend/src/core/database.py defaults.
local DB_URL="${DATABASE_URL:-${POSTGRES_URL:-postgresql+psycopg2://postgres:postgres@localhost:5432/ss_tools}}"
# SQLite does not require external service.
if [[ "$DB_URL" == sqlite* ]]; then
echo "Database preflight: sqlite detected, skipping PostgreSQL connectivity check."
return
fi
local DB_HOST DB_PORT
read -r DB_HOST DB_PORT < <(
python3 - "$DB_URL" <<'PY'
import sys
from urllib.parse import urlparse
url = sys.argv[1]
if "://" not in url:
print("localhost 5432")
raise SystemExit(0)
# Support SQLAlchemy schemes like postgresql+psycopg2://...
scheme, rest = url.split("://", 1)
parsed = urlparse(f"{scheme.split('+', 1)[0]}://{rest}")
host = parsed.hostname or "localhost"
port = parsed.port or 5432
print(f"{host} {port}")
PY
)
local check_cmd
check_cmd='import socket,sys; socket.create_connection((sys.argv[1], int(sys.argv[2])), timeout=1).close()'
if python3 -c "$check_cmd" "$DB_HOST" "$DB_PORT"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
echo "Database preflight: reachable at ${DB_HOST}:${DB_PORT}."
return
fi
echo "Database preflight: cannot connect to ${DB_HOST}:${DB_PORT}."
# For local development defaults, attempt to auto-start bundled PostgreSQL.
if [ "$DB_HOST" = "localhost" ] && [ "$DB_PORT" = "5432" ] && command -v docker >/dev/null 2>&1; then
if [ -f "docker-compose.yml" ]; then
echo "Attempting to start local PostgreSQL via docker compose (service: db)..."
docker compose up -d db || true
fi
fi
for _ in {1..20}; do
if python3 -c "$check_cmd" "$DB_HOST" "$DB_PORT"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
echo "Database preflight: reachable at ${DB_HOST}:${DB_PORT}."
return
fi
sleep 1
done
echo "Error: PostgreSQL is unavailable at ${DB_HOST}:${DB_PORT}."
echo "Run: docker compose up -d db"
echo "Or set DATABASE_URL/POSTGRES_URL to a reachable database."
exit 1
}

# Cleanup function for graceful shutdown
cleanup() {
echo ""
echo "Stopping services..."
# Phase 1: kill by tracked PID (process substitution ensures correct PID capture)
if [ -n "$BACKEND_PID" ]; then
kill -TERM $BACKEND_PID 2>/dev/null || true
fi
if [ -n "$FRONTEND_PID" ]; then
kill -TERM $FRONTEND_PID 2>/dev/null || true
fi
if [ -n "$AGENT_PID" ]; then
kill -TERM $AGENT_PID 2>/dev/null || true
fi
# Phase 2: wait for graceful exit (up to 2s), then force kill
sleep 1
if [ -n "$BACKEND_PID" ]; then
kill -KILL $BACKEND_PID 2>/dev/null || true
fi
if [ -n "$FRONTEND_PID" ]; then
kill -KILL $FRONTEND_PID 2>/dev/null || true
fi
if [ -n "$AGENT_PID" ]; then
kill -KILL $AGENT_PID 2>/dev/null || true
fi
# Phase 3: fuser fallback — kill anything still on our ports (belt-and-suspenders)
if command -v fuser &>/dev/null; then
fuser -k ${AGENT_PORT}/tcp 2>/dev/null || true
fuser -k ${BACKEND_PORT}/tcp 2>/dev/null || true
fuser -k ${FRONTEND_PORT}/tcp 2>/dev/null || true
fi
echo "Services stopped."
exit 0
}
# Trap SIGINT (Ctrl+C), SIGTERM (kill), and SIGHUP (terminal close)
trap cleanup SIGINT SIGTERM SIGHUP
